The Javelin’s Capabilities
The Javelin missile system is designed to engage and destroy armored vehicles, including tanks, and fortified positions such as bunkers and fortresses. It is a fire-and-forget missile system, meaning that once launched, the missile locks onto its target and tracks it until impact. The Javelin has a top-attack mode, which allows it to destroy targets that are protected by armor.
